Common Causes of Asus Server Data Loss
Asus servers are widely utilized across various industries due to their reliability and high performance. However, like any technology, they are not immune to data loss, which can disrupt business operations and lead to significant challenges. Understanding the common causes of data loss can help organizations take preventive measures and respond effectively when issues arise.
Accidental Deletion and Human Errors
Mistakenly deleting critical files or data can result in immediate data loss, impacting operations.
Software or File System Corruption
Corrupted software or damaged file systems can render important data inaccessible.
Virus Attacks and Malicious Programs
Cyberattacks, including malware and viruses, can compromise server integrity and lead to extensive data loss.
Server Hardware Failure
Physical damage or malfunctions in server components, such as hard drives or RAID controllers, can disrupt data storage and accessibility.
Fire, Water, or Environmental Damage
Incidents such as fires, flooding, or exposure to extreme conditions can physically damage server infrastructure and compromise data.
Natural Disasters
Events like earthquakes, floods, or severe storms can impact server facilities and result in data loss.
Power Outages and Surges
Sudden power failures or electrical surges can lead to server malfunctions, data corruption, or complete system failures.
